Output deb644105bd00bd886eb28c81bf79f1b032453c366ba0c7ae9df4cadf31aa574:1

value
317434
script pubkey
OP_0 OP_PUSHBYTES_20 8ee66da17cfaa1cfe4b6f4fbe989695d41a117cf
address
bc1q3mnxmgtul2sule9k7na7nztft4q6z970falrzt
transaction
deb644105bd00bd886eb28c81bf79f1b032453c366ba0c7ae9df4cadf31aa574
spent
true